Equestrian activities. Horses are often bothered by flies and insects around their ears and head, which can cause distraction and discomfort during riding or work. This fly veil provides a physical barrier to protect the horse's sensitive ears and eyes from pests, promoting a calmer and more focused performance.

Q: What material is this fly veil made of?
A: This fly veil is typically made from a combination of breathable fabrics like polyester and spandex for the ear covers, and a crochet or mesh material for the main body.
Q: How do I ensure the correct fit for my horse?
A: Measure your horse's head from the brow band area to the bottom of the jaw. Compare these measurements to the product's size chart. Ensure it fits snugly but not tightly, especially around the ears and eyes.
Q: Can this fly veil be washed?
A: Yes, most fly veils are machine washable on a gentle cycle with cold water and mild detergent. It is recommended to air dry to maintain the shape and material integrity.
